Overview
Purpose of Role: To create, agree and establish a Catalyst Support corporate partnership programme that is capable of generating £100k of income per annum (in donations or kind) from Surrey-based organisations that have synergy with Catalyst Support purpose and goals.
Responsibilities
* Build a good understanding of Catalyst Support, its purpose, its goals, the team, sources of finding and types of clients.
* Define the Catalyst Support corporate partnership programme, value proposition and content, review and agree this through the team and obtain SLT commitment.
* Work with the marketing director and team to define a promotional programme, including personas, target companies, marketing tools, digital content and the sales process.
* Manage the testing and implementation of this programme to the point where the first Corporate Partnerships are signed.
* Potentially continue to manage the programme through longer-term results.
* Build and agree a workable programme within the Catalyst Support positioning, values and resources.
* Get buy-in across the whole organisation, led by the SLT.
* Monitor the efficiency and effectiveness of the promotional programme.
* Track the number of partners engaged, awareness benefits and income potential, and ensure compliance with Data Protection policy.
